# Postmortem follow-up: stale-cache bug (incident NV-208)
#
# Context for reviewers: the Quillbarn catalog service was serving
# stale price data because cache invalidation events were silently
# dropped when the Mossgate relay restarted. This env file adds the
# settings agreed in the postmortem: TTLs are now capped at 300
# seconds via CACHE_MAX_TTL, and INVALIDATION_RETRY is enabled so
# dropped events are replayed from the journal. The relay connection
# itself is authenticated, which is why the line below is required:

env line for kageg-fajof: COURIER_KEY5=93d14

// MIGRATION NOTE for the release manager:
// This constant marks the cutover date for moving legacy cron jobs
// into the Driftwheel workflow engine. After this date, the old
// crontab on the batch host is considered read-only; any schedule
// change must go through a Driftwheel workflow definition instead.
// Jobs not yet migrated will keep running from cron until their
// owning team files a migration ticket. Do not bump this date
// without sign-off from platform ops. The build that set the
// current value is recorded below.

pipeline stamp: htk9_ce63042d9

Step 6 — Verify slimmed image

After the Trimforge pass removes build tooling and unused locales from the Cobaltine base image, confirm the final size is under the 180 MB budget and that the runtime smoke tests still pass. Reviewers should diff the layer manifest against the previous release. Sign the approved manifest with the key below.

deploy key for yagap-kawig: bky4_Q8dK

The committee reviewed terms offered by Hollis & Brayne Property for the Eastvale and Norwick branches. Proposed rent reductions of 11% were deemed acceptable contingent on a five-year term and a break clause at year three. Facilities will audit maintenance obligations before signature. Managers should defer any local landlord conversations until head office concludes negotiations. Timeline: final terms expected within four weeks. Context on our wider intentions appears in the confidential note below.

internal memo for tajof-kaduf: Only 65 of the 511 pilot accounts renewed Lamdor, so a churn review is set for January 26. Aldmirek Works is in early talks to buy Alddorox Works for about $490.9 million.